Garlic Butter Steak Lightning Noodles

  • Author: Sally Thompson
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: 3-4 servings 1x

Description

A quick and luxurious noodle dish featuring tender steak, a silky garlic butter sauce, and perfectly cooked noodles. Garlic Butter Steak Lightning Noodles is the perfect meal when you want bold flavors and comforting textures—all ready in about 30 minutes.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 12 oz steak (sirloin, ribeye, or flank)
  • 8 oz noodles (linguine, spaghetti, or your choice)
  • 3 tbsp butter
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ce
  • 1 tbsp oyster sauce (optional)
  • 1 tsp sesame oil
  • 1/2 tsp red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1 tbsp sesame seeds
  • Salt & pepper to taste
  • Cooking oil (for searing)
  • Reserved pasta water (about 1/2 cup)

Instructions

  1.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ook noodles according to package directions. Reserve 1/2 cup pasta water, then drain.

  2. Pat steak dry and season both sides with salt and pepper.

  3. Heat o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Sear steak 2–4 minutes per side until desired doneness. Remove from pan and let rest.

  4. In the same skillet, lower heat to medium. Add butter and melt. Add minced garlic; cook for 1 minute until fragrant.

  5. Stir in soy sauce, oyster sauce (if using), and sesame oil. Add a splash of reserved pasta water to loosen sauce if needed.

  6. Add cooked noodles to the pan and toss to coat.

  7. Thinly slice rested steak against the grain. Plate noodles, top with steak.

  8. Garnish with red pepper flakes, sesame seeds, and fresh parsley. Serve hot.
